Arriving at Redditch Theory Test Centre

By public transport

Before you even think about answering the questions correctly, you need to work out how you’re going to arrive at the test location! For those who live locally, this could be as simple as a quick stroll from your front door. People heading into Redditch from out of town, however, may need to navigate public transport.

If you arrive at Redditch train station, you’ll find that getting to the theory test centre involves a fairly straightforward 8-minute walk. Simply head down Unicorn Hill and along Church Green West. Those taking the bus should get off at the Baptist Church bus stop on Easemore Road. From here it should only take you 4 minutes to reach the test centre on foot.

By car

We know that some learners are chauffeured around by their nearest and dearest. If this is the case, or indeed if you just want to pay for a taxi, let the driver know that the postcode of your destination is B97 4DL. A sat nav should be able to take care of the rest!

A handy tip: the theory test centre sits just off the Redditch Ringway/B4160. Keep an eye out for the Fish Hill turn off once you’re on this road and you’ll be at your test in no time!

Parking

Those driving learners to their test may be a little dismayed to find that the Redditch theory test centre does not provide on-site parking. This can be a bit of a pain if the plan was to ditch the car for a couple of hours. Do not fret, though, as there are affordable parking options nearby!

The Kingfisher Shopping Centre car park (B97 4AB) is an 8-minute walk from the test centre and charges a very reasonable £1.50 for 2 hours of parking. The closest option after that is Redditch Station car park (B97 4RB). It’s roughly 13 minutes from your destination, but charges a more pricey £3.20 for the same amount of time.

Pass Rates by Year

The good news is that the pass rates at Redditch theory test centre have been consistently above average. The bad news is that this changed in 2019-20. That being said, these figures don’t really have any bearing on how well you are likely to do if you sit your test here. If we’re really honest, the theory test is the same wherever you happen to take it. Focus more on studying than the statistics!

2015-16 2016-17 2017-18 2018-19 2019-20 2020-21 2021-22
49.6% 49.8% 51.5% 49.1% 47.0%  57.5% 56.9% 

Guides and Tips

In preparation for the theory test, it’s really important that you understand what’s expected of you on the day. The theory test is split into two sections: multiple choice questions and a hazard perception test. You must achieve a pass mark on both sections to earn an overall pass!
